911爆料 Community College Named A Finalist For The 2023 Aspen Prize By The Aspen Institute For Community College Excellence For Third Time
Today, the Aspen Institute College Excellence Program named 911爆料 Community College (KCC) one of 10 finalists eligible for the Aspen Prize for Community College Excellence. Generously funded by Ascendium, the Joyce Foundation, JPMorgan, and the Kresge Foundation, the Aspen Prize, which offers $1 million in shared prize funds, is the nation鈥檚 signature recognition of community colleges that are achieving high, improving, and equitable outcomes for students. This year鈥檚 finalists also include sister CUNY institution Hostos Community College.
Awarded every two years since 2011, the Aspen Prize honors colleges that show outstanding performance in five critical areas: teaching and learning, certificate and degree completion, transfer and bachelor鈥檚 attainment, workforce success, and equitable outcomes for students of color and students from low-income backgrounds. KCC has been placed in the top 150 or better seven consecutive times since the prize鈥檚 inception. This marks the third time the College has been named a finalist. The winner will be announced in the spring of 2023.

The Aspen Prize selection process began in October 2021, when the Aspen Institute worked with an expert data panel to craft a formula to assess student outcomes at nearly 1,000 community colleges in key areas such as retention, completion, transfer, and equity. Based on the data, 150 community colleges were invited to apply. A selection committee of 16 higher education experts reviewed the 109 applications received, including extensive data and narratives on student success strategies. From the 25 highest ranking colleges, announced as semifinalists in April, the committee met in May to choose the 10 Aspen Prize finalists. Next steps include:
鈥 Fall 2022: Additional data gathered on student outcomes, including in employment after college;
multi-day site visits to each of the 10 finalists to gather insights about effective
practices
鈥 Winter of 2023: A distinguished jury decides the Aspen Prize winner, based on quantitative data
and qualitative information from each of the 10 finalists.
鈥 Late spring 2023: Announcement of the Aspen Prize winner
